Control of the Motion App (app control)
The information for controlling the Motion App is specified using bits 7 … 6 in byte 0 (PDO).
The exact function is specific to the Motion App and can be found in the manual of the Motion App.
Setting the Motion App (app option)
The setting of a Motion App is specified using byte 1 (PDO).
The exact function is specific to the Motion App and can be found in the manual of the Motion App.
"Setpoint value 1" and "setpoint value 2" sections (setpoint1, setpoint2)
Setpoint values for executing a Motion App are specified using the bytes 5 … 4 (PDO) (setpoint
value 2) and 3 … 2 (PDO) (setpoint value 1).
The exact function is specific to the Motion App and can be found in the manual of the Motion App.
3.5.2.2
Structure of the input data (PDI)
When a Motion app is running, the 6 bytes of input data (PDO) for each valve slot are divided into 3
sections:

Operating mode of the valve (valve mode)
The valve mode that is currently active is returned using bits 5 … 0 in byte 0 (PDI).
